generating the simulation data to apply in brace
brace
gendat(nsims, nobs, f, g, b, w1, w2, omegaplus, theta1, theta2, k3)
a matrix of nsims*nobs row, which consists of nsims datasets
number of simulation datasets
number of observations for one dataset
parameter for generating unmeasured binary confounder
parameter for generating group assignment
confounder effect on group assignment
shape parameter in generating survival time for event 1 from weibull distribution
shape parameter in generating survival time for event 2 from weibull distribution
multiplier on the baseline hazard for event 1
multiplier on the baseline hazard for event 2
nsims = 1; nobs = 1500 f = 0.5; g = 0.333; b = 8; w1 = w2 = 0.667 theta1 = 0.5; theta2 = 1; omegaplus = 1; k3 = 0.333 sim1 = gendat(nsims,nobs,f,g,b,w1,w2,omegaplus,theta1,theta2,k3)
